Streets Rich with History and Views

Walking through the streets, you’ll notice the neighborhood’s evident vitality and colorful storefronts. Your guide shares tales of the area’s past, including its German settlers and waves of Dominican migration. This historical context gives the food even more meaning—each restaurant and shop is a piece of the neighborhood’s evolving story.

Plus, the tour offers views of stunning skyline vistas — from certain vantage points, you can see the Manhattan skyline framed by the lush greenery of Inwood Hill Park. These fleeting moments of scenery are appreciated by many visitors, who note that the neighborhood’s natural beauty complements its cultural richness.

The Lively Final Stop on Dyckman Street

The tour concludes on Dyckman Street, famed for its lively vibe. This stretch comes alive with music, dance, and street art, embodying the spirit of Washington Heights.
